About Delta Airlines
Delta Airlines, Inc. is a leading American airline founded in 1924 as Huff Daland Dusters and began passenger services in 1929. As one of the largest and oldest airlines in the world, Delta operates a vast network of domestic and international flights, serving destinations across six continents. As a Full Stack Security Analyst, you will be responsible for the following key areas:- Regulating information security tools, including installation, upgrading, investigating, testing, and reporting.
- Auditing data loss prevention (DLP) alerts within a specified timeframe.
- Maintaining the DLP software upgrade schedule to test and upgrade our technical solutions continuously.
- Resolving DLP alerts by implementing remediation procedures and defensive controls.
- Testing and tuning data identification solutions to reduce false positives.
- Creating guides to investigate, test, and implement new features within our toolsets.
- Fostering new strategies using regex, AI, fingerprinting, and dictionaries to monitor unique data types.
- Collaborating with other business areas to report identified business processes handling sensitive information and provide best practice suggestions.
- Ensuring existing business processes meet information security best practices, approving processes, and proposing security upgrades.
- Implementing proposed upgrades to the organization.
- Collaborating with the business to lead discovery outputs to identify sensitive data, auditing results with data owners, and providing guidance on safely storing that information.
- Auditing existing organizational design, architecture, and strategies and evaluating overall compliance against best practices.
- Assessing and developing new information security solutions in accordance with cloud requirements, operationalizing these solutions to deliver value to the business.
- Executing defensive controls in the cloud to ensure the privacy, integrity, and availability of information.
- Successfully communicating information security ideas to non-technical business leaders.
